Under a microscope you observe a tissue that appears to have long fibers that appear striated. the nuclei are pushed off to the

side of the fibers. the tissue looks very vascular. what type of tissue are you observing?

I believe the correct answer is skeletal muscle tissue.

<h2>Explanation:</h2>

Skeletal muscles under a microscope are striated and their nucleus is not centered. This is to enhance the communication between different cells for coordinated functioning. They also are multi nucleic.

The cells of skeletal muscles are tightly packed and have musculoskeletal junctions and neuromascular junctions that they use to communicate from one cell to another to provide contraction of the muscle. At the neuromascular junction, they communicate with motor neurons that receive signals from the brain through the spinal cord. Signals from the brain are converted into nerve impulses that cause the production of acetylcholine at the synaptic cleft found at the axon terminal of the motor neuron and the end plate of the skeletal muscle. Acetylcholine is the neurotransmitter used for contraction of the skeletal muscles.

Now that you have identified the components of DNA, can you describe how these components bind together to form a DNA molecule?

1. DNA is the polymer of deoxyribonucleotides that contain the nitrogenous base, pentose sugar and phosphate group. The phosphate is attached with the 3 C position of the deoxyribose sugar. This leads to teh formation of phosphodiester bond.

2. The DNA backbone consists of phosphate and sugar. The nitrogenous bases are inserted inside the DNA molecule. These nitrogenous bases are linked together by the hydrogen bonds.

3. The adenine binds requires two hydrogen bonds to bind with thymine. This provide complementary nature to the DNA molecule. Uracil is present instead of thymine in RNA .

4. The guanine binds requires three hydrogen bonds to bind with cytosine. More amount of energy is required to break their bonds.
